EVALUATION OF EFFICACY OF MENTZER INDEX FOR SCREENING OF BETA - THALASSEMIA TRAIT IN ANTENATAL WOMEN

Abstract

Introduction: The individuals with thalassemia trait usually have an asymptomatic course and have mild microcytic hypochromic anemia. As the other cause of microcytic anemia is iron deficiency, it is important to differentiate it from thalassemia trait. Objective: To evaluate efficacy of Mentzer index for screening of Beta Thalassemia trait in antenatal women. Methods: This observational study was conducted in Gynaecology & Obstetrics Department of Sri Guru Ram Das Charitable Hospital Amritsar from Jan 2023 to Oct 2023. A total of 130 antenatal women with mild anemia were included in the study. For evaluation of microcytic hypochromic anemia Complete Blood Count, Peripheral Blood Smear, iron studies and Hb electrophoresis done. Sensitivity and specificity of Mentzer Index was calculated. Results: Out of total 130 patients with microcytic hypochromic anemia, 112 had Mentzer Index >13. 18 had Mentzer Index13. In current study Mentzer Index had sensitivity and specificity of 80 % and 95.65 % for beta thalassemia trait and 95.33% and 86.96% for IDA. Conclusion: Mentzer Index can be used as differentiating tool between iron deficiency anemia and beta thalassemia trait. High risk groups can then undergo definitive diagnostic tests. This can be helpful in resource poor settings for better compliance and cost effectiveness.
